Biography
"ETHRYG, ETHERIDGE, or, as he writes himself in Latin, EDRYCUS (George) was king’s professor of the Grecian tongue at Oxford, about 1533; but having been active against the protestants in queen Mary’s reign, was forced to leave it on the accession of Elizabeth, He practised physic afterward at Oxford, and took care of the sons of catholic gentlemen. He was a sincere man, a great mathematician, eminent for Greek and Hebrew learning, a physican, well skilled in music, and a poet. He left works both printed and MSS."
